National – September 15, 2025 – The Project Management Institute (PMI), the global authority in project management, today announced the successful conclusion of its 17th annual Project Management South Asia Conference (PMSAC) 2025. Held at Anvaya Conventions in Hyderabad, the conference, themed “Aim High. Achieve MORE,” convened over 1200+ delegates and 20+ speakers – a diverse group of project professionals, industry leaders, and policymakers from across South Asia. Discussions centered on the evolving project management landscape and the pivotal role of AI-powered skills in driving future-ready project success.
The conference agenda and theme were deep-rooted in PMI’s foundational M.O.R.E. philosophy—Manage Perceptions, Own Project Success, Relentlessly Reassess, and Expand Perspective.
